I am looking at 2 case 750 crawlers. both are dozers and each has a different engine. one is a A-301D and the other is a A-267D. both have the 4 way blade, both are in great condition. the one is a 1967 and has a cab and winch setup and is painted red.

I was wondering which was the better engine and which is the easiest to still get parts for.

also, where do youa guys get parts for 750 crawlers? I have a case IH dealer close to me. I just want to make sure I can keep the thing runnning before I purchase it. any help is appreciated.

Dave, Parts book shows 267 as the original engine, 267 is basically the 730 farm tractor engine , and the 301 is the 830 tractor engine . Basic difference is bore size one is 4 1/8 , other is 4 3/8 , both 5 inch stroke . 750 was a somewhat short run for production , not alot of them sitting around.
